Telangana HC orders interim stay on panchayat elections after petitions challenge backward class res...

HYDERABAD: Hours after the Telangana State Election Commission issued a notification for conducting the elections to the local bodies in the state on Thursday, the Telangana High Court ordered an interim stay on the Panchayat elections. Nod to travel abroad: Give details of 'business trip', HC tells Shilpa & Raj | Mumbai News - The Tim...

Mumbai: Bombay high court on Wednesday sought details on an affidavit from actor Shilpa Shetty and her husband Raj Kundra on why she needs to go abroad and include formal communications about her "business trip".The couple had petitioned HC for permission to travel to Colombo and other locations. They need court permission since there is a lookout notice (LOC) against them in an alleged Rs 60-crore fraud case. They filed a petition seeking quashing of the LOC. Assam To Set Up Judicial Commission To Probe Zubeen Garg's Death: CM Himanta

Guwahati: Assam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ma on Friday said a judicial commission will be formed to probe the death of the state's cultural icon Zubeen Garg. The commission will be headed by Justice Soumitra Saikia of the Gauhati High Court, he said in a Facebook live. "We will form the commission tomorrow. Disqualification pleas: Tribunal to resume hearings today

HYDERABAD: The Tribunal led by Assembly Speaker Gaddam Prasad Kumar, which is looking into the disqualification petitions filed against the 10 BRS MLAs who allegedly defected to the ruling Congress, will resume its hearings on Wednesday. The Tribunal began hearings under the Tenth Schedule of the Constitution on Monday. Delhi HC junks FIR, asks accused to hold 'bhandara' for poor kids on Navratra, Diwali

New Delhi, Sep 30 (PTI) The Delhi High Court has quashed an FIR against a married couple for allegedly hurting and criminally intimidating their neighbour and ordered them to hold a "bhandara" for poor children on Navratra and Diwali. Justice Anish Dayal passed the order on September 19, observing a settlement was reached between the accused persons and the complainant. Calcutta HC quashes deportation of 6 migrant workers, orders repatriation in 4 weeks

The Calcutta High Court on Friday overturned the Centre's June deportation of six West Bengal residents, including pregnant Sunali Khatun, to Bangladesh, ordering their repatriation within four weeks. The court ruled the deportation illegal, citing violations of fundamental rights and lack of proper verification. Conflict between personal laws, national legislation warrants legislative clarity: Delhi HC

The Delhi High Court, while granting bail to a 24-year-old man accused of marrying an alleged minor, raised the need for a Uniform Civil Code to resolve conflicts between personal laws and national legislation. Justice Arun Monga noted Muslim law permits marriages after puberty, but Indian criminal law deems them offences, urging legislative clarity for legal certainty and social harmony. SC poses queries to Rajasthan in suo motu case over lack of functional CCTVs in police stations

New Delhi, The Supreme Court on Friday posed questions to the Rajasthan government and directed it to apprise about the number of CCTV cameras installed in each police station across the state. Acting in a suo motu case, the top court asked whether any regular audit was conducted to check the functioning of the installed cameras.
